N555 MLR is a 2007 Nissan Pickup in Black with a 2,488c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2007 Nissan Pickup models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.6% with a typical mileage of 75,482 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Nissan Pickup f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 9,683 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N555 MLR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Pickup typ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 19 years old, this Nissan Pickup is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
